Default Printing black on black?

Hello all! First poster here. Hope you can help.

I built an image in Corel that uses a black starfield. That is, the image is an outer-space starfield that is mostly black with some stars and galaxies in white.

I have made it totally B&W. On top of that image I added some text in a bright yellow.

There is no border around the image, but my concern is the transition from the black shirt and the printed black starfield will be noticeable.

Will that work OK or is there a way to make sure only the stars print (white) and use the black of the shirt as the background?

Default Re: Printing black on black?

You would be fine to leave out your black color entirely and rely on the shirt for your black. Otherwise, sooner or later the black will show as a black square on your fading shirt.
